Between the Lines | A Namasport Reflective Book Club
6:00 PM MST / 7:00 PM CST
Between the Lines is a Namasport clinician-led offering designed to support intentional readings and community reflection. This book club creates space to slow down with meaningful texts—exploring ideas, language, and frameworks that shape us.
Each gathering invites thoughtful discussion, curiosity, and connection, balancing clinical depth with the human heart. Alongside conversation, sessions will include a grounding somatic practice to help integrate what we’re reading—inviting the body into the learning process and supporting insight beyond the intellectual.
Come as you are. Reflect. Stay connected to yourself.
Our April book will be Homecoming by Thema Bryant .
The session will be led by Namasport clinician, Maggie Medzigian.
Feel free to connect with the book in the format that best supports your rhythm—reading in print or listening to the audiobook are both welcome.
